Ralf Rangnick has been praised for the way in which he has handled the public fallout with Anthony Martial. The interim boss claimed after Manchester United’s 2-2 draw with Aston Villa on Saturday that Martial had refused to play, with the German having planned on including him in his squad at Villa Park.
The French international though hit back on social media hours later, insisting: “I will never refuse to play a match for Man United” as he refuted Rangnick’s version of events.
Martial has not featured for United since the 3-2 win over Arsenal December 2, and has informed Rangnick of his desire to leave the club during the January transfer window.
